A few days ago, I was playing with my six year old cousin, Joey. He wanted to play with his pro wrestling action figures. Now I do not approve of the no holds barred standards of modern day professional wrestling. I feel that it is similar to the gladiatoral competitions, in ancient Rome. But what I experienced next was even more provocative. I was handed a white wrestler, and Joey likewise had one. He then took out a ninja figurine. He said that the two of us were going to attack the ninja. I asked why. He said that the ninja is evil. I asked what is so evil about him. He told me that the ninja wants to take over the world. And that besides, I wouldn't want to be the ninja, because the ninja isn't as powerful as the wrestlers. Later on it hit me. This was how Hitler and his Nazis were able to convince the German people to go along with the Holocaust. First they tell the people that the enemy(like the Jews) are evil. Then you tell them that the enemy is trying to take over you. Then finally they claim that, even if you still doubt that the supposed enemy is an evil threat to the nation, the enemy deserves to be defeated, because they are inferior untermenschen, while we are a master race of supermen. I can just imagine what it would have been like if television were to have existed in the 30's and 40's. In Nazi Germany, like our "Power Rangers", they may have had something called, "The Aryan Troopers". And they'd have them swoop down like knights in shining armor, to fight against caricatures of Jews, and/or other groups which the Fascist regime found to be undesirable. It works on adults too. As Hermann Goering said, "Why of course the people don't want war. Why should some poor slob on a farm want to risk his life in a war when the best he can get out of it is to come back to his farm in one piece? Naturally the common people don't want war. Neither in Russia, nor in England, nor for that matter in Germany. That is understood. But, after all, it is the leaders of the country whom determine the policy and it is always a simple matter to drag the people along, whether it is a democracy, or a fascist dictatorship, or a parliament, or a communist dictatorship. Voice or no voice, the people can always be brought to the bidding of the leaders. That is easy. All you have to do is tell them they are being attacked,and denounce the peacemakers for lack of patriotism and exposing the country to danger. It works the same in any country."
